Having fished this ground for 20yrs, Both shore and boat,
Kilteery Pier for the novice best catch ....cold
Walk west off pier app 1/2 mile very good for ray.
Glin......Hit and miss.
Barrett Strand Huss Conger Dogs
Tarbert Pier.....Conger
Small Pier....Flats
Carrig Island.....Mainly Dogs
Best Fishing...2hrs before low 2hrs after.
